Abstract

We introduce a new family of continuous models called the log-logistic generalized family mathematical properties. of distributions. beta odd We study some of its Its density function can be symmetrical, left-skewed, right-skewed, reversed-J, unimodal and bimodal shaped, and has constant, increasing, decreasing, upside-down bathtub and J-shaped hazard rates. Five special models are discussed. We ob- tain explicit expressions for the moments, quantile function, moment generating function, mean deviations, order statistics, Renyi entropy and Shannon entropy. We discuss simulation issues, estimation by the method of maximum likelihood, and the method of minimum spacing distance estimator. We illustrate the importance of the family by means of two applications to real data sets.
